摘要
目的 :观察丘脑中央下核 (Sm)神经元对伤害性机械刺激 ,手针和电针刺激的反应特性。方法 :在麻醉大鼠 ,用玻璃微电极细胞外记录的方法 ,观察 Sm神经元对上述刺激的反应。结果 :大多数对手针刺激反应的神经元一般地也对伤害性皮肤或肌肉机械刺激发生反应 ,这些神经元也对电针刺激穴位发生反应 ,其反应随刺激强度、串长或重复次数的增加而加强 ,揭示针刺与伤害性机械刺激具有相同的属性。结论 :Sm可能在针感形成及针刺兴奋细纤维产生的镇痛中起重要作用。
Objective:To observe the response characteristics of neurons in the thalamic nucleus submedius (Sm) to different stimuli in the rat.Methods:The experiments were conducted on 23 anaesthetize rats. The single unit activity was recorded extracellularly from the Sm with a glass micropipette, and the responses of neurons in Sm to noxious mechanical, needling and electrical acupuncture stimuli were observed.Results:Most(97 3%,46/58) of the neurons in Sm responded to needling acupuncture stimulation of points. In general, the neurons which responded to needling acupuncture stimulationalso responded to noxious cutaneous or muscle mechanical stimuli. These Sm neurons also responded to eletro-acupuncture stimulation, and the responses of neurons increased following the increase of the stimulation intensity, the train length and repetitive numbers. These results suggested that the properties of the acupuncture stimulation are similar to those of the noxious mechanical stimuli.Conclusion:It is possible that the Sm plays an important role in the needling sensative formation and the analgesia produced by acupuncture activation of the small afferent fibers.
